The manufacturers of hydraulic pumps and fans have long understood the interest of electronic speed variation (ESV). The importance of electronic speed control is becoming increasingly important in refrigeration and air conditioning engineering, and compressor manufacturers are offering INVERTER technology in particular. Without a special control system, a refrigeration plant is not very interesting from an energy point of view. Although variable speed compression is a very promising solution, there are a number of obstacles, such as interference with the electrical network, noise pollution and lubrication of the refrigeration compressor.
